student loans are usually federally backed and their threats can not be empty. They do not need a judgment to impose garnishment or seize your tax refunds. They also have no statue of limitations. So call the collection company, enroll in the federal loan rehabilitation program and it will go back into good standing after 9 to 12 payments. You will then have the derogatory trade removed from your credit report and you can move on with your life. payments in the program are usually 1 to 3 % of the balance of the loan. Garnishment payments are usually 15 % of your net pay. hope this helps.
credit cards need judgment to impose involuntary collection actions, you can sue credit card collections that threaten you for adverse action that are not intended.
Student loan debt is tax deductable and credit card debt isn't.
Generally, credit card debt has higher interest than student loan debt. You get student loan debt by doing the responsible thing of going to school. You get credit card debt by doing the irresponsible thing of spending more than you earn.
